website logo
Auteur
avatar
zzd10h

Forum » » Création-Développement » » question multiview


Posté : 22-10-2012 00:48 icone du post

Juste pour étre sûr que ta fonction DEPlaySound laisse le temps à DTMethodA de jouer le son,
peux-tu ajouter un petit "Delay(100)"
Entre

????????AESound[?iID?].dores?=?IDataTypes->DoDTMethodA(?AESound[?iID?].dtobje ct,
????????????????????????????????????????????????????????NULL,?NULL,?(Msg)&myd tt?);

Et

? ? ? AESound[ iID ].Playing = 1;?

Parce que là, je ne vois pas de boucle d'attente de signal pour laisser le son finir et envoyer son signal de fin...

je suis sur un autre projet pour lequel je me sers des datatypes sons et du signaling et je n'ai pas de problème de lecture.

Pour le pb de delete de repertoire,
ça ma fait ça aussi avec des apps MUI, dés le 1er openlibrary MUI (j'ai testé en ayant qu'un open/close MUIMaster.library) si et seulement si le prog à un .info et qu'il a été lancé au moins une fois avec en info "démarré depuis le workbench".
Bizarre en effet...ça fait peut-étre ça aussi avec d'autres library que MUI...

A+





Cet article provient de Le site des utilisateurs francophones actuels et futurs d'AmigaOS 4.x
https://amiga-ng.org/viewtopic.php?topic=1380&forum=14